Frequently asked questions

What is yakiniku beef?

Yakiniku beef is a Japanese style grilled meat, primarily consisting of thinly sliced beef that is cooked over a grill.

What is the best cut of beef for yakiniku?

Typically, yakiniku uses thin slices of beef from various parts of the cow, with popular choices being rib eye, short rib and sirloin.

Is yakiniku beef healthy?

While the beef itself is high in protein, mind that the marinade and sauces can add a significant amount of sodium and sugar. Eating in moderation is the key.

What does yakiniku taste like?

Yakiniku beef has a savory, sweet and smoky flavour. It is tender and juicy due to the flavorful marinade it's often soaked in.

How long should yakiniku beef be cooked?

Since yakiniku is thinly sliced, it should be grilled for only about a minute on each side over high heat.

Is yakiniku the same as Korean BBQ?

While both involve grilling meat at the table, they are not entirely the same. The main difference lies in the type of meat and sauces used for marinating.

Is yakiniku beef always served in thin slices?

Most commonly, yes. Thin slices of beef are ideal for the quick-cooking process of yakiniku.

How is yakiniku beef prepared?

Yakiniku beef is often marinated in a soy-based sauce before it is cooked. It is then grilled over a tabletop barbecue grill, often by the diners themselves at the table, and eaten right off the grill.

What kind of sauce is used for yakiniku beef?

Yakiniku sauce typically includes soy sauce, sugar, garlic, fruit juice, sesame seeds, sesame oil, and sometimes mirin or sake. It can be either store-bought or homemade.

What is the origin of yakiniku beef?

Yakiniku originated from Korea during the early 20th century and introduced to Japan. The term 'yakiniku' itself is a Japanese word that means 'grilled meat'.

Why is yakiniku beef so popular in Japan?

Yakiniku beef is popular in Japan because it's more than just a meal, it's a social event where diners grill their own meat at the table.

Do I need a special grill for yakiniku beef?

While in Japan a special small gas or charcoal grill is used, yakiniku can be cooked on any standard barbecue grill.

Can I use other meats for yakiniku?

Yes, yakiniku is not limited to beef. It can also be done with pork, chicken, seafood and even vegetables.
